      @@INUMIMI28 That's not exactly true. Pretty much every transmission in Mazda's catalog is shared with Nissan or Toyota because of either JATCO or Aisin-Warner respectively. Non-turbo RX7s usually got a M-series manual (M5M-D I think), while their turbo siblings received the R-series boxes. FD RX-7 is R15M-D and is a little weaker than the FC version. Crunchy 5th gear synchros are a common issue with FD transmissions. The HB Cosmo and HB/HC Luce/929 got the same transmissions too.
      Some early Z31 Turbos got a Borg-Warner T-5 World Class transmission from the factory thanks to the Aisin Warner partnership. Z32s got the JATCO RE4R01 (non-turbo) and RE4R03 (Turbo), which Mazda used in the Cosmo, named R4A-EL and Q4A-EL respectively. And in an ironic plot twist, both were used in the R32-R34 Skyline too. If they had made a R32 GT-R with an automatic, it would undoubtedly be a RE4R03, the same one Nissan put behind their V8s.
      So all of the groundwork was in place for Mazda to call Toyota (Aisin Warner) and ask them nicely to send over a prototype Viper T-56 6-speed manual. Most of the patents were already on file in 1990 here in the US. Name would probably be something like Q36M-R or something.

    Corrections required.......
    Eunos lasted from 88 - 02
    L10 Cosmo was "not" the 1st rotary powered car in 1967. The NSU Spider was in 1963
    JC Cosmo production ceased JUN-1995, not in 1996
    Your "feature car" is a 90-91 Type-S version, as shown by the trim
    Production was 1990-95
    The most valued versions today are the series-2 (94-95) Type-SX
    Mazda USA almost imported LHD versions under the defunct Amati sales channel scheduled for 1992 & there was debate whether to go with the 20B-REW or develop a new V12 engine due to emission's difficulties from 3-rotors & CAL regulations
